Livorno: Information meeting of the force with the citizens at the church of Santa Teresa di Calcutta
The Carabinieri have been dedicating a long time on a national scale, particular attention to the phenomenon of scams against the elderly. About that, the Provincial Carabinieri Command of Livorno, in close continuity with the operational directives shared by the Committee for Public Order and Safety at the Prefecture of Livorno, conducts a widespread information campaign throughout the territory to spread, as much as possible, knowledge of this phenomenon laying the foundations and providing tools to potential victims to prevent the evolution of criminal dynamics as well as defend themselves by adopting all the precautions deemed appropriate in light of constant monitoring and analysis of the phenomenon.
In this context the Carabinieri Company of Livorno has held an open meeting with the citizens of Livorno at the church of Santa Teresa di Calcutta to Salviano and aimed especially at the older population, given that, in this specific case and from an analysis of the crime in its specificity, it emerges that the chosen victims in most cases concern a group of people such as the elderly or single women.
On this occasion The Commander of the Carabinieri Station of Ardenza provided the participants with some suggestions, also through the distribution of information brochures, to better protect citizens and the elderly from this type of scam. This was the theme of the information meeting, aimed at providing important information on how to behave in the face of possible scams both inside and outside your own homes, and above all, on how to unmask criminals. In any case, two pieces of advice apply: do not let strangers into your home and, if in doubt, call 112 immediately. The carabinieri then called some suggestions for preventing scams and frauds which are the subject of meetings now organised on a regular basis with the citizens of the province of Livorno in the various municipalities.
In particular, During negotiations it is advisable to use direct communication tools, such as telephone calls, which are more easily traceable than simple messages via social networks and to verify, even via the web, the real presence of companies or resellers. In case of doubt, you can always contact one of the 27 Carabinieri Stations in the Province of Livorno to expose your suspicions and verify any doubts. The recurrence of different types of scams requires recalling the precautions and measures that The Carabinieri of Livorno recommend in case of doubts and/or lack of knowledge of the interlocutor from whom you are approached for any type of agreement or request in which the request to carry out an operation or a payment emerges, even and above all with means other than the use of cash, in particular the use of electronic payment instruments.
In this regard in the above cases, As soon as you have suspicions, the advice is to be extremely careful, not to open the door to strangers who show up at private homes, to be wary of appearances and above all to limit your confidence on the Internet. In this perspective therefore, always pay maximum attention, but above all, contact the Carabinieri with confidence in case of suspicion, calling 112 to make an immediate report, as well as consult the site Carabinieri.it in which The main types of scams and how to recognize them are illustrated, since the techniques adopted by scammers, however sneaky and imaginative, have recurring patterns and identifying them is the first step in defending yourself.
In case of receiving calls from landline or mobile numbers with prefixes or numbers compatible with the sender, for example from institutional offices or barracks, since currently frequent phenomena of cloning of already assigned numbers, It is good practice to hang up, then close the suspicious conversation and call the number back in order to confirm that you are not dealing with yet another unknown scammer.
